The day started with shuttle transfers from various hotels to the Treasure Island Hotel, where we boarded our tour bus. The bus was equipped with power outlets for charging devices and had plenty of bottled water available. After about two and a half hours on the road, we stopped at a gas station for a restroom break and snacks. The journey then continued for another two hours before we reached our first destination. Horseshoe Bend We had an hour to explore Horseshoe Bend. However, from the parking lot to the viewing point, it’s a 950-meter walk. The downhill trek to the site is quicker, but the uphill return takes more time, so it’s important to plan accordingly. If you’re late returning to the bus, the tour guide has the right to leave without you! The view of Horseshoe Bend was breathtaking and well worth the effort, but time management is key. Lower Antelope Canyon Unlike Horseshoe Bend, there’s no need to worry about timing at Lower Antelope Canyon. Local guides manage the schedule and ensure everything runs smoothly. The descent into the canyon is steep, so you need to be cautious. The canyon itself is stunning, with its beautiful curves and vibrant colors. This part of the trip felt well-paced and stress-free. For lunch, we were provided with simple sandwiches, which were convenient and filling enough for the day. The Return Journey On the way back to Las Vegas, the bus stopped at another rest area for snacks and a restroom break. However, the drop-off locations in Las Vegas were different from the morning pick-up spots. The bus only stopped at three locations: Treasure Island Hotel, Aria Hotel, and MGM Grand, which are spread across the northern, central, and southern parts of the Strip. Travelers need to choose their drop-off point based on their hotel or plans for the evening. The Tour Team Our guide, Marvin, was friendly and informative. He shared insights about the sights and explained important safety tips for entering Lower Antelope Canyon. The driver, Gracie, was excellent—always maintaining a safe speed and even managing to get us back to Las Vegas earlier than expected. We arrived at Aria Hotel around 6:30 PM, which gave us time to relax and enjoy the evening. Overall, the trip was well-organized and enjoyable. I’d highly recommend it to anyone planning to visit these iconic destinations. Just remember to plan your return drop-off carefully and keep track of time at Horseshoe Bend!
